Devotional: Harmony at Home – Cultivating Peace in Family Life
Scripture Reading: Ephesians 4:2-3 (NIV)
"Be completely humble and gentle; be patient, bearing with one another in love. Make every effort to keep the unity of the Spirit through the bond of peace."
Reflection
Home is often referred to as a sanctuary—a safe haven where love, support, and understanding should thrive. Yet, in the busy rhythms of life, it can be easy to let misunderstandings, impatience, and conflict disrupt our peace. The call to cultivate harmony in our homes is met with the realization that it requires intentional effort, humility, and grace.
The Apostle Paul emphasizes vital qualities: humility, gentleness, patience, and love. These aren’t just traits we admire in others; they are the building blocks of a peaceful family life. Just as in our relationship with God, fostering peace within our homes hinges on our willingness to be humble and make sacrifices for others’ wellbeing.

Action Steps
-
Start with Yourself: Examine how your actions and reactions affect family dynamics. Ask God to help you embody the traits of humility and gentleness.
-
Communication is Key: Set aside time for open conversations with family members, focusing on listening rather than responding. Validate their feelings to create a culture of respect.
-
Practice Forgiveness: Identify any lingering grudges in your home. Choose to forgive, extending grace as Christ forgives us.
-
Create a Family Ritual: Establish a regular family time—be it a meal, game night, or prayer session—to strengthen bonds and foster understanding.
-
Pray Together: Make prayer a part of your family life. It cultivates a sense of unity and brings God into the heart of your home.
Closing Thought
As you navigate family life, remember that harmony is not the absence of conflict but the commitment to respond with love and patience amidst it. By being intentional in our actions and anchored in Christ, we can cultivate a home where peace reigns and God’s love is evident. Let us strive to keep the unity of the Spirit in our families, reflecting His kindness and grace in our everyday interactions.
